Output 66824f3853bab5518182630a9487ae41b8cf456433fb000f6421dcc84200186e:1
- value
- 1505626
- script pubkey
- OP_0 OP_PUSHBYTES_20 57d4614e9957e363cb1b4716adf5521b790f141b
- address
- bc1q2l2xzn5e2l3k8jcmgut2ma2jrdus79qmh0nmm4
- transaction
- 66824f3853bab5518182630a9487ae41b8cf456433fb000f6421dcc84200186e
- confirmations
- 89781
- spent
- true